Advanced Cleaning with Laser Technology

The implementation of laser technology has revolutionized the field of precision cleaning. Lasers, capable of emitting highly focused beams of energy, offer an unparalleled level of precision in removing contaminants from delicate and intricate surfaces. This technique is particularly valuable in industries requiring exceptional cleanliness, such as aerospace manufacturing. Laser cleaning eliminates the need for harsh chemicals or abrasive materials, minimizing damage to sensitive components and reducing environmental impact.

Unveiling the Potential of Laser Cleaning for Corrosion Removal

Corrosion, a pervasive and destructive force, can severely impact the integrity and more info functionality of various materials. Traditional cleaning methods often prove ineffective or destructive, leaving behind residual contamination or altering the surface properties. However, a revolutionary technology is emerging to combat this challenge: laser cleaning. By harnessing the power of focused light, lasers can effectively eliminate even the most stubborn corrosion without causing injury to the underlying material.

  • This revolutionary approach relies on the precise delivery of high-intensity laser pulses, which generate localized heating that rapidly vaporizes the corroded layer.
  • The process is highly selective , meaning it focuses solely on the corroded material while leaving the surrounding surface pristine.
  • Laser cleaning offers a range of benefits, including enhanced material preservation, reduced environmental impact, and improved safety compared to conventional methods.

The versatility of laser cleaning extends across diverse industries, finding applications in aerospace, construction, and art conservation. As the technology continues to advance, laser cleaning is poised to revolutionize corrosion removal, offering a efficient solution for preserving the integrity and lifespan of valuable assets.
